OUR MISSION

Healing the Spirit Productions is a national Indigenous non-profit organization dedicated to improving Indigenous Men’s Health by promoting and facilitating healthcare education through culturally relevant initiatives.

We recognize the unique challenges that Native American Men face, including higher rates of health disparities, which can be attributed to historical intergenerational trauma and inequity. These often contribute to higher death rates, depression, stress, and other social detriments of health. Our programs and services aim to address these issues while promoting healthy lifestyles, physical activity, and mental wellness through a cultural lens.

Healing the Spirit Productions connects Indigenous Men & Two-Spirit (2S) to cultural, spiritual, physical, mental health & wellness through community education, collaboration, and advocacy – inspiring and empowering them to live longer, healthier and happier lives.

WHAT WE DO

We partner with tribal communities, businesses and organizations across the nation to provide culturally relevant events, workshops, retreats, and resources that help Native American Men connect with their cultural heritage, promote cultural resilience, strengthen family ties, and ultimately improve their health and well-being. 

We facilitate Active Engagement Programming (AEP) that encompasses our 4 Pillars of Health — which empowers Native American Men to improve their physical, mental, spiritual and cultural well-being by utilizing modern and traditional healthcare practices and cultural teachings. Our programming integrates Indigenous Foundations — which is health education awareness in the 4 Stages of Life; providing a structure to address the healthcare needs and begin to decrease the health inequities Native American Men face by age groups.

Health awareness information, disease prevention tools, screening programs, educational materials, and advocacy opportunities are ways in which we can support and empower Native American Men to take an active role in their health and wellbeing.

We facilitate programs which positively impact Indigenous Men’s Health through various stages and places of their lives, ie. where they live, work, play, and pray. Through awareness and education of modern medicine and traditional healthcare for men of all ages; the collective power to improve the quality of life becomes a reality. Together we can create ways to help healthy men transform into healthy families and healthy communities; building a healthier tomorrow.

Healing the Spirit Productions works to ensure diverse community perspectives are involved in creating change and championing policies and strategic plans, recommendations, and implementation of activities that address health disparities to form health equity.
